Transaction ec73f7940f0e28b753a67ddd025f6ac2a3cbf072bf8cf707576f2f3de179fd87

1 Input
2 Outputs
  • ec73f7940f0e28b753a67ddd025f6ac2a3cbf072bf8cf707576f2f3de179fd87:0
  • value  7363715
    address  3HRBHdJyfSCSmuvyhzdau9iUvNwFQMkpcN
  • ec73f7940f0e28b753a67ddd025f6ac2a3cbf072bf8cf707576f2f3de179fd87:1
  • value  17200903
    address  3QoRcStfbUwPd31Kx9xJZJeZGYsCJPvAdz